T.J. Warren scored a career-high 53 points in the Indiana Pacers' 127-121 win over the Philadelphia 76ers.

Warren was 20 of 29 from the field and 9 of 12 from 3-point range in his first game with at least 50 points.

 

"I was very excited coming into the game. I knew I wanted to get going," Warren said. "Came in with the same mentality as other game. Fortunate enough to make some shots tonight and get the win."

Warren had only hit 40 points once before in his career.
